Ingredients
– 1 large flatbread or naan
– 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
– 1 cup burrata cheese
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Fresh basil leaves, for garnish
– Balsamic glaze, for drizzling
– Optional: Red pepper flakes, for added spice
Step-by-Step Instructions
Creating Tomato Burrata Flatbread is straightforward and rewarding. Follow these steps to bring this dish to life:
1. Preheat the Oven: Set your oven to 400°F (200°C) to prepare for baking the flatbread.
2. Prepare the Flatbread: Lay the flatbread on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
3. Drizzle Olive Oil: Brush the olive oil evenly over the flatbread for flavor and to help it crisp.
4. Season the Base: Sprinkle salt and pepper over the olive oil for added flavor.
5. Add Tomatoes: Arrange the halved cherry tomatoes evenly on the flatbread.
6. Bake: Place the baking sheet in the oven and bake for about 10 minutes, or until the edges are golden.
7. Add Burrata: Carefully remove the flatbread from the oven and place the burrata cheese in the center.
8. Return to the Oven: Bake for an additional 2-3 minutes until the burrata is warm and slightly melty.
9. Garnish: Remove the flatbread from the oven and garnish with fresh basil leaves.
10. Drizzle with Balsamic Glaze: Finish with a drizzle of balsamic glaze and a sprinkle of red pepper flakes, if using.

Additional Tips
– Use Fresh Herbs: Enhancing your Tomato Burrata Flatbread with fresh herbs like thyme or oregano can add an aromatic layer to the dish.
– Experiment with Cheese: If you can’t find burrata, consider using fresh mozzarella or ricotta as alternatives to maintain the creamy texture.
– Serve with a Side: Pair the flatbread with a fresh tomato salad or a side of roasted vegetables for a balanced meal.

Freezing and Storage
– Storage: Keep your Tomato Burrata Flatbread in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
– Freezing: While it’s best enjoyed fresh, you can freeze the flatbread without the toppings.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and store it in a freezer bag for up to 2 months.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use regular tomatoes instead of cherry tomatoes?
Yes, you can use regular tomatoes; just be sure to slice them thinly and remove excess moisture.
How do I make the flatbread gluten-free?
You can use gluten-free flatbread or naan as a substitute for the standard version.
Can I add protein to this flatbread?
Absolutely! Grilled chicken or prosciutto can be delicious additions.
What can I use instead of balsamic glaze?
A drizzle of extra virgin olive oil and a squeeze of lemon juice can serve as a light alternative.
Can I prepare this dish in advance?
While it’s best enjoyed fresh, you can prepare the ingredients in advance and assemble it just before baking.
